What was supposed to be a day of relaxation turned into a day that shocked many residents.

On Saturday, February 5 residents of Blackhill called the police after a fight transpired in the neighbourhood.

Police arrived at the scene next to the old Ogies Road, where other residents were gathered at the gate of a house.

As they entered, they found a man who was lying face down with wounds on his head, arm and upper body.

He was declared dead on the scene.

Upon investigation, police found out through eyewitnesses that there was a fight that had led to the man being stabbed.

Another man that was allegedly part of the fight was said to have gone to the hospital as he had also sustained injuries during the fight.

A case of murder was opened and the suspect is known to the police.
